            <title>[MC-2401] On SMP When using using a shovel to destory dirt/sand no block lag, without a shovel block lags</title>
                <link>https://bugs.mojang.com/browse/MC-2401</link>
                <project id="10400" key="MC">Minecraft: Java Edition</project>
                    <description>&lt;p&gt;On a survival, mulitplayer, vanilla server I and fellow minecrafters on the server, with no lag (like chests and doors, and logging in, shows no normal signs of the usual lag experienced sometimes on minecraft)but when using no tool at all to destroy dirt (bare hands) the block does not drop and leave item to pick up until 5-20 seconds after rightfully destroyed. however when I used my diamond, eff 4/5 shovel It did drop when it should have, no lag at all. This does not happen in SSP, So it could be possibly the actual server connection. but of this I&apos;m not sure&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Update (11/11/12) Everybody else on the server has been having the issue, The blocks that are affected include obsidian, Coal and other ores, Stone, Dirt, Sand, Clay and chests. Also wood and stonebrick are affected. Some ways to avoid it are to use efficiency picks/ shovels but this can still be annoying. It definitely does not happen in SSP and other things, like opening doors, and eating is not laggy at all. Some users have speeds around 15 - 20 mb/s and still get this lag. So I am confused to how/why this is happening.   &lt;/p&gt;</description>
